【问题标题】:PHP - base64_decode GET FILE INFORMATIONPHP - base64_decode 获取文件信息
【发布时间】:2018-10-14 11:58:24
【问题描述】:

我有我的 Android 客户端 - 它将二进制 base64 发送到 PHP 服务器(图像 - JPG/JPEG)。

这是我的 PHP 服务器代码,用于保存图片并解码二进制文件。

现在我想检查有关文件的更多信息,例如 FileSize、FileType 但我发现没有可能的功能。我试过哑剧类型,但我做不到。

谁有我的例子吗?

$base=$_REQUEST['image'];

$binary=base64_decode($base);

header('Content-Type: bitmap; charset=utf-8');

$file = fopen('uploaded_image.jpg', 'wb');

fwrite($file, $binary);

fclose($file);

echo 'true';

谢谢

【问题讨论】:

    标签: php base64 decode


    【解决方案1】:

    你可以使用

    $desc_array = stat('uploaded_image.jpg');
    

    获取更多信息,例如

    $desc_array["size"];
    

    http://php.net/manual/de/function.stat.php

    【讨论】:

    • 非常感谢您的快速回复。所以我必须在保存图片后启动 $desc_array 吗?因为我认为如果我可以在图像保存之前检查它会更安全
    猜你喜欢
    • 1970-01-01
    • 2017-12-08
    • 2013-10-29
    • 1970-01-01
    • 2018-03-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-01-23
    相关资源
    最近更新 更多